Output bfbbdc83c19a4bf100203f7621cfc219da9852e6417c9fdd03591db1bc954a52:0

value
170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d4aec8fced24ac337c133205ef2bf09c1bcfc64 OP_EQUAL
address
34MuGvTLGL7daQ4CP9oyPF8rdfmhdwbFnx
transaction
bfbbdc83c19a4bf100203f7621cfc219da9852e6417c9fdd03591db1bc954a52
confirmations
399244
spent
true